About Marcille
The name Marcille is of French origin and is derived from the Latin name Marcellus, meaning "young warrior" or "dedicated to Mars." It is a feminine form of the name and carries the same connotations of strength, bravery, and determination. Marcille is a unique and elegant name that embodies qualities of resilience and courage.
